4. Make Passwords Strong and Secure
The next factor to keep your QB online data safe is to protect all your office PCs and devices with a strong password. Not only this but you also need to have a strong password for QuickBooks Online Login.
Keep in mind that weak passwords are extremely easy to guess for hijackers. A strong and secure password is a combination of upper case letters, lower case letters, special symbols, numbers, etc. Do not ever use your birth date, name, spouse's name, home address, mobile number, and other personal data as a password.

6. Set Up Two-Factor Authentication
In order to access most networks and servers, you required a username and password. Once you use two-factor authentication, it adds another verification form. For instance, a unique code is sent to another device. You need to enter this code to allow access. This method is pretty simple to use.
